Discover the Louvre’s Treasures with the Private Mona Lisa First Access Tour
Imagine stepping into one of the world’s most famous museums—the Louvre—when it’s still quiet and peaceful, with the chance to see the Mona Lisa up close before the crowds arrive. This private tour, priced at around $249 per person, lasts about 90 minutes and promises a more intimate, less rushed experience of Paris’s iconic art collection. Led by a knowledgeable guide—Diane in some reviews—you’ll gain access to the museum early, avoiding long lines and the typical tourist rush.
What we particularly love about this experience is the early access that lets you see the Mona Lisa in a near-private environment—a luxury for such a celebrated masterpiece. Plus, the tour doesn’t just stop at the Mona Lisa; it includes highlights like the Venus de Milo, the Winged Victory, and the Coronation of Napoleon. A secondary perk is the personalized guidance; you’re free to ask questions and receive tailored recommendations for the rest of your time in Paris.
A possible consideration is that this is a shorter, focused tour. If you’re looking for a comprehensive, all-day Louvre experience, this might feel a bit limited. Nevertheless, for those who want to see the highlights efficiently, especially the Mona Lisa without the usual crush of travelers, this tour hits the mark.
This experience is ideal for art enthusiasts, first-time visitors, or anyone eager to see the Mona Lisa in a relaxed and exclusive setting. It’s especially suited for travelers who value expert guidance, want to maximize their limited time, and appreciate the advantage of skipping long lines.

A Deep Dive into the Louvre First Access Tour
The Louvre is a sprawling treasure trove of art, with over 35,000 works on display in hundreds of rooms. Navigating it on your own can be overwhelming, especially during peak hours. That’s where this private tour offers a distinct advantage: it’s designed to give you early entry, so you’re among the first to step inside when the museum opens.
The Benefits of Early Access and a Private Guide
Starting at 8:30 am, you meet near the Louis XIV sous les traits de Marcus Curtius statue, at the Cour Napoléon, right by the pyramid. From this point, your guide—who has a knack for storytelling—takes you through the highlights, starting with the Mona Lisa. The reviews highlight how valuable it is to see her without the crowds, with Vivian_C noting, “The highlight for me was seeing the Mona Lisa without the crush of travelers.” This is an experience many travelers refer to as a “once-in-a-lifetime” moment, especially with a near-private viewing.
You’ll also explore the Da Vinci corridor, the Italian Renaissance section, and other masterpieces like the Venus de Milo and the Winged Victory. These pieces are iconic, and seeing them with a knowledgeable guide makes the experience richer, as you’ll learn fascinating stories and details you might not catch on your own.
What the Tour Includes — and What It Doesn’t
The cost covers admission tickets, so there’s no fuss about lines or tickets. Your guide provides a guided tour of the Louvre’s highlights and offers a chance to ask as many questions as you want—an advantage over large group tours. The tour ends back at the meeting point, giving you ample time to continue exploring or relax in the museum’s cafes.
Food and drinks are not included, so plan to bring a snack if you’re hungry afterward. Gratuities are optional but appreciated if you enjoy the guide’s insights.
The Itinerary Breakdown
- Start at the Cour Napoléon with early entrance, beating the crowds to the Mona Lisa.
- First stop: Mona Lisa for a close, quiet view—many reviewers mention how special this is. Jeff_S called it “the only way to do the Louvre,” highlighting how quickly you see her with no line.
- Next, explore the Louvre highlights like the Venus de Milo, the Winged Victory, and Napoleon’s Coronation, giving you a snapshot of the museum’s most celebrated works.
- Additional rooms like the Jewelry Room are also included, offering a little extra in-depth experience.

Frequently Asked Questions
How early do I need to arrive for this tour?
You meet at 8:30 am near the Cour Napoléon, right outside the museum, which is the designated start time for the tour.
Are tickets included?
Yes, the admission tickets to the Louvre are included, meaning you skip the line and go straight inside.
Is this a private tour?
Yes, only your group participates, ensuring a more relaxed and personalized experience.
How long is the tour?
The guided part lasts approximately 90 minutes, after which you are free to stay and explore the Louvre at your own pace.
Can I ask questions during the tour?
Absolutely. The guide is there to answer all your questions and provide insights, making it highly interactive.
Is this tour suitable for all ages?
Most travelers can participate, but keep in mind the walking involved and the need to stand for periods.
What should I wear?
Comfortable shoes are recommended, especially since you’ll be moving quickly to see the highlights before the crowds arrive.
What other highlights will I see besides the Mona Lisa?
Expect to see works like the Venus de Milo, Winged Victory, the Coronation of Napoleon, and the Jewelry Room.
